I created this recipe this past October and originally called them "Pink Awareness" Mini Fillo Shells in honor of Breast Cancer Awareness Month. These little bites are packed with creamy yet intense cherry flavor.

Steps:
- 1. Heat oven to 350 degrees F. "Crisp" phylo shells as directed on package. Place on flat work surface to cool.
- 2. Meanwhile, in a medium size bowl, cream together the cream cheese and confectioners' sugar. Mix well until combined. Add the whipped topping and beat until no lumps remain. Stir in 2 tablespoons of the cherry juice.
- 3. Carefully spoon filling into each shell, mounding slightly. Press 1 whole cherry into each.
- 4. Garnish with a sprinkling of confectioners' sugar.
